Avanos Medical (AVNS) Non-Current Assets (2016 - 2026)

Avanos Medical's Non-Current Assets history spans 13 years, with the latest figure at $718.3 million for Q4 2025.

  • On a quarterly basis, Non-Current Assets fell 5.59% to $718.3 million in Q4 2025 year-over-year; TTM through Dec 2025 was $2.9 billion, a 33.52% decrease, with the full-year FY2025 number at $718.3 million, down 5.59% from a year prior.
  • Non-Current Assets hit $718.3 million in Q4 2025 for Avanos Medical, roughly flat from $716.3 million in the prior quarter.
  • Over the last five years, Non-Current Assets for AVNS hit a ceiling of $1.3 billion in Q1 2022 and a floor of $683.0 million in Q2 2025.
  • Historically, Non-Current Assets has averaged $1.1 billion across 5 years, with a median of $1.2 billion in 2021.
  • Biggest five-year swings in Non-Current Assets: increased 10.53% in 2022 and later crashed 42.3% in 2025.
  • Tracing AVNS's Non-Current Assets over 5 years: stood at $1.2 billion in 2021, then dropped by 1.12% to $1.2 billion in 2022, then grew by 3.66% to $1.2 billion in 2023, then tumbled by 36.88% to $760.8 million in 2024, then decreased by 5.59% to $718.3 million in 2025.
  • Business Quant data shows Non-Current Assets for AVNS at $718.3 million in Q4 2025, $716.3 million in Q3 2025, and $683.0 million in Q2 2025.
